What are people using for e-mail in Windows 7? My client has been using Outlook Express, but just received a new W7 machine that does not appear to have a mail program already installed. She needs to be able to import her OE mail and contacts and would prefer to be able to use as many of the same keystrokes she did in OE as possible. Does anyone have any suggestions?
